Shaan Taseer, one of the former governor’s sons, reacted to the news of Qadri’s execution by writing on his Facebook page that “a principle had been upheld”.
“I commend the judiciary, the president and the police for staying the course and doing their duty. And I thank them for honouring his memory,” he wrote, adding in Urdu: “Long live Pakistan.”
